Output 6ef251b59a203f45d37440862e4c0adba7cbf71e4c1bcdeb942a8d0e8fb022bc:0

value
318890
script pubkey
OP_0 OP_PUSHBYTES_20 b8f834a7b7d14115f5f3f8b7996f94a52d9779e3
address
bc1qhrurffah69q3ta0nlzmejmu555kew70r43z2f8
transaction
6ef251b59a203f45d37440862e4c0adba7cbf71e4c1bcdeb942a8d0e8fb022bc
confirmations
56682
spent
true